Kukreja leads rally
Mumbai, pti:

Sahil Kukreja slammed an unbeaten 89 as Mumbai fought back against Delhi on the second day of their Ranji Trophy Super League Group A tie here on Saturday.
The hosts first restricted the visitors’ first-innings lead to 85 by dismissing Delhi for 251, and then surged to 154 for two at close.

Brief scores: Group A: In Mumbai: Mumbai: 166 all out in 44.3 overs and 154/2 in 44 overs (Sahil Kukreja 89 n.o.) vs Delhi: 251 all out in 86.4 overs (Gautam Gambhir 89, Rajat Bhatia 49, P Bishy 35; Ajit Agarkar 2-52, Avishkar Salvi 3-44, Abhishek Nair 2-52). In Dharamsala: Maharashtra: 310 all out in 110 overs (Y Venugopala Rao 112, Sairaj Bahutule 74, Salil Agharkar 46; Ashok Thakur 3-86, Vikramjeet Malik 4-69, Jitender Mehta 3-88) vs Himachal Pradesh: 83 all out in 51 overs (Wahid Sayyed 2-7, Samad Fallah 2-34, Sairaj Bahutule 5-29) and 41/2 in 15 overs (Mukesh Sharma 25 n.o.; Samad Fallah 2-18). In Jaipur: Saurashtra: 307 all out in 120.4 overs (Sitanshu Kotak 58, Cheteshwar Pujara 32, Jaidev Shah 71, Rakesh Dhruv 46 n.o.; Pankaj Singh 4-91, Afroz Khan 2-33, M Aslam 3-54) vs Rajasthan: 155/6 in 55 overs (Gagan Khoda 44, Nikhil Doru 29, V Saxena 26; S Jobanputra 2-40, Rakesh Dhruv 2-35).

Group B: In Hyderabad: Hyderabad: 261 all out in 103.4 overs (Daniel Manohar 71, Ravi Teja 72, Anoop Pai 62; Irfan Pathan 4-71, Sumit Singh 3-39, Rajesh Pawar 2-55) vs Baroda: 191/2 in 75 overs (Connor Williams 91 n.o., A Bilakhia 68; Pragyan Ojha 2-49). In Chandigarh: Punjab: 381 all out in 105 overs (Pankaj Dharmani 46, Uday Kaul 162, Rakesh Inder 45, Charanjit Singh 40; Praveen Kumar 4-60, Sudeep Tyagi 3-107, Piyush Chawla 2-84) vs Uttar Pradesh: 352/7 in 66 overs (RP Srivastava 40, Saurabh Shukla 25, Mohammad Kaif 66, Suresh Raina 123, Piyush Chawla 30 n.o.; Vikram Rajvir Singh 5-102). In Cuttack: Andhra: 179 all out in 79.3 overs and 67/2 in 21 overs vs Orissa: 140 all out in 76.4 overs (Niranjan Behera 31, H Das 30; Y Gnaneswara Rao 2-15, Hemal Watekar 5-32).

Plate Division scores: Group A: In Guwahati: Assam: 198 all out in 66.5 overs and 152 all out in 49.3 overs (S Suresh 45; Sreekumar Nair 3-11, T Yohannan 3-46) vs Kerala: 85 all out in 52.2 overs (R Prem 20; D Suresh 4-23, D Goswami 4-24) and 11/0 in 4 overs. In New Delhi: Gujarat: 437 all out in 137.4 overs (Niraj Patel 145, Bhavik Thaker 121, S Trivedi 51 n.o; Ashish Mohanty 5-113) vs Services: 40/6 in 26.4 overs (Mohnish Parmar 4-14). In Nagpur: Vidarbha: 315 all out in 132.4 overs (F Fazal 110, A Naidu 87; TK Chanda 4-68, V Jain 3-51) vs Tripura: 80/5 in 45 overs (R Saha 22 n.o; M Acharya 3-19.

Group B: In Margao: Madhya Pradesh: 475 all out in 131.5 overs (Jatin S Saxena 103, Ashutosh Jadhav 93 n.o, M Ali 88; S Bandekae 6-144) vs Goa: 145/3 in 45 overs (S Asnodkar 64 n.o, J Arunkumar 34; S Pitre 2-27). In Rohtak: Haryana: 193 all out in 67.4 overs vs Railways: 272/5 in 109.4 overs (Sanjay Bangar 64, Amit Pagnis; S Rana 3-40). In Jammu: Jharkhand: 105 all out in 33.1 overs (Vijay Sharma 5-20, S Beigh 4-50) and 278/7 in 90 overs (M Vardhan 79, S Tiwary 64 n.o; Sameer Ali 2-40) vs J&K: 133 all out in 33.3 overs (S Beigh 33 n.o; K Sharma 3-57, S Rao 3-56).
